Bio

Darol Joseff, M.D., is a Board certified Nephrologist and Internist. He completed his Medical Degree at the University of Cincinnati School of Medicine and his fellowship and residency training at Harbor UCLA Medical Center, and at Santa Barbara Cottage Hospital. Dr. Joseff has written numerous articles for medical journals. He is also on the faculty of the University of Southern California Medical School and is active in teaching for the residency programs at Cottage Hospital. Recently, Dr. Joseff was awarded Teacher of the Year by the Resident staff at Cottage Hospital. Dr. Joseff has a private practice specializing in Nephrology in Santa Barbara and is on the medical staff at several hospitals. Dr. Joseff communicates with his patients and colleagues via telephone, email, listservs, and the Web.
